Republic Bank (Ghana) PLC Honoured as Financial Partner of the Year at GUTA Corporate Awards 2026

Accra, Wednesday, 15 April 2026 – Republic Bank (Ghana) PLC has been proudly recognised as the Financial Partner of the Year at the prestigious Corporate Awards organised by the Ghana Union of Traders Association (GUTA). The award ceremony, held on 11 April 2026, celebrated institutions and individuals making outstanding contributions to Ghana’s trading community and broader economy.

This recognition underscores Republic Bank’s longstanding role as a trusted financial partner to GUTA and its members. For years, the Bank has consistently supported Ghana’s vibrant small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s) and traders through innovative and accessible financial solutions.
